Why look for a Webflow alternative?
Webflow charges per site and per workspace. A multi-brand company with 5 sites on CMS + a Pro workspace hits $300+/month easily.
Teams usually start looking for a Webflow alternative for three reasons. First, the price — line-item pricing (seats + add-ons + overages) makes budgeting a guessing game, and the bill grows faster than headcount. Second, lock-in — Webflow owns your data schemas, your automations, and often your team's muscle memory. Migration feels scarier than the pricing pain, so teams stall. Third, limited customization — you can configure Webflow, but you cannot change it. The moment you need behavior Webflow does not offer, you build a brittle external service that glues to it through their API, inheriting all their rate limits.
